A red title in Texas signifies a salvage vehicle. This means the car has been damaged to the extent that the insurance company deemed it a total loss. Vehicles with red titles are often repaired and can be roadworthy, but they might have underlying issues. Always get such a vehicle thoroughly inspected before purchasing to avoid expensive repairs down the line.
